2015 McLaren passes FIA Crash Tests

In the week when the newly reformed McLaren-Honda partnership announced its driver lime-up for the 2015 Formula 1 season, the team have announced that their 2015 car has already passed the mandatory FIA Crash Tests. With testing not due to begin until February 01st at the Spanish circuit of Jerez, the team are the first to confirm that their car for 2015 has passed the tests, although McLaren have yet to announce the date when their MP4-30 will be launched.
